I think this is a good summary of our conversation.

As for how to handle external_id, I think a compromise might be:

  • The taxonomy editor UI displays external IDs, but doesn't allow changing them. It may allow specifying them when creating a tag, and/or generate one based on the value if none is specified.
  • In the rare case where an external ID needs to be changed, that can be easily done by an administrator using the Django admin UI.
